  3. In my current swarm, one solar sail produces 65,6 MJ over a lifetime of 1800s
    Launching one solar sail costs 3,6MJ and producing one solar sail in an MK III assembler costs 1,04 MJ(not counting further down the supplyline), the sorters needed to move the Graphene the "Protein" Combiners and Solar Sails around, up to the gun
    costs 0,072 MJ (not so sure on that one)

    So your actual concern should be the sail lifetime and Ray transmission efficiency upgrade wise.
    Your orbital elements and placement of Ray recievers matters too.

    After having done further math: Maintaining 1200 sails without any upgrades needs 2 sails launched every 3 seconds, that comes down to 4 guns anywhere but the poles and 1.5 mkII assembles CONTINOUSLY making sails and buffering enough over night.
    and you will get 12.5 MW with one POLAR Ray receiver.

    I think it was designed to be feasible for anybody with a factory, that can manage blue and red cubes production.

  7. For power – Wind is really good since it outputs at a constant rate. Solar outputs less and is intermittent, so you'll either need to make a solar belt, or add accumulators. Dyson Swarm is not bad – sure, it eats some resources, but it's a good way to power all of your planets in a solar system easily, and using less space. Plus you'll need the Swarm to feed the Sphere eventually.

    Interplanetary power transmission is a bit of a disappointment until the game patches some sort of "consume only as much power as you need" setting – it's a machine that takes accumulators, charges them, and spits them out charged, and can do vice versa. So you're shipping rechargable batteries around with it and interplanetary logistics.

  13. 1 – Solar Sails transmit power to your Solar Receiver. But when the receiver is on the dark side of the planet, it receives no power from sails. Placing multiple receivers is recommended.
    2 – You could replace your Titanium storage with a Intraplanetary Station, since it will be receiving Titanium from the Interplanetary Station eventually. (It has 5x storage slots of 10k each)
